                            Here's my take on Friday's game...

                            Boston College: This isn't the same BC team Vermont saw last fall. The frosh are now seasoned and scoring is pretty much spread across 4 lines, and all 4 lines can certainly fly. UVM will have a hard time with BC's depth at forward, as they can wear you down cycling and with speed and intensity.
                            It’s what did UMass in last week… their top 2 lines and D pairings got an awful lot of ice time and just couldn’t keep up over 60 minutes.

                            The D has me a little bit worried (including ‘team D’). They progressed so well over the season but didn’t have great series’s against UNH or UMass last weekend. Some bad turnovers and poor decisions with the puck in our zone could have been more costly than they were. They threw an awful lot of pucks into traffic when we had an open man on the far backside of the net with no pressure that way. I’m sure the coaching staff will have that straightened out this week.

                            Goaltending… No worries.

                            Vermont: What can you say about a team with their backs to the wall, in hostile territory, on the big sheet, and holding one of Hockey East’s top offensive teams to goose eggs two nights in a row to take the series?!!!! That’s pretty darn impressive stuff right there.

                            I didn’t see the games but can guess they did a great job of filling passing lanes and keeping UNH out on the perimeter. I heard the last 20 minutes or so of the final game and sounded like Madore was on his game. If VT can shut down UNH like that they can certainly do the same to BC (as they have shown already in 2 of 3 meetings).

                            Look out for a kid like McCarthy. He’s had some big games already against us, which always seems to be the case when a kid is recruited and then is playing for another team. The Eagles had better be paying attention when he’s on the ice.

                            Prediction: Vermont will certainly hit BC every chance they get to take them off their game and wear them down. BC is a far better team when they hit than when they try to just out-talent an opponent. Their speed is far more dangerous when they’re hitting. The team that wins the physical battle will win this game. That’s my 2 cents.
